Transaction ff3a6d72eb4b66e689c4750323a76bac0d78e23af44a85e7db43240ed807c907

404 Input
2 Outputs
  • ff3a6d72eb4b66e689c4750323a76bac0d78e23af44a85e7db43240ed807c907:0
  • value  1000000
    address  36LSAWerc11rw1mDFEYQTSp7o54z7Lenfx
  • ff3a6d72eb4b66e689c4750323a76bac0d78e23af44a85e7db43240ed807c907:1
  • value  363814445
    address  3Qf4e6MMSnteTVE1xuMr5y5Mdimh7Ghqsy